The National Enquirer reports at 12:48 PM -0700 6/3/04, George Mogiljansky wrote: >Hi all, >This is is the card: >The card is made by QPS >The CB/NO:0211065161 >It supportrs OHCI, IEEE1394 and 1394A supplement. >up to 63 devices simultaneously, Compatible with >windows >98/SE/ME/2000/XP. >Will it work on a Wallstreet Series II with either OS >9 or X or both? It should work if it's a Type I or Type II PC card. The Mac requires OHCI compliancy which that card has. Chances are that it will work with the Apple OS FireWire drivers in OS 8.6-9.2.2. But you may have problems using it with OS X. FWIW you might want to check out the IBM cardbus (was $26 at Computer Geeks at one time).
